Public figures are frequent targets for fabricated lookalike rumors or generic viral clickbait. When users search for a celebrity's name alongside sensational terms like "MMS leak," automated scripts detect the sudden or sustained search volume and instantly generate placeholder web pages matching that exact phrase.
